Understanding First Time Car Buyer Programs in California

First time car buyer programs are designed to assist individuals with little to no credit history in purchasing a vehicle. These programs often come with benefits like lower interest rates or flexible loan terms, making car ownership more accessible. While California doesn’t have statewide specific “first time buyer programs” directly run by the state, various dealerships and financial institutions offer programs tailored to first-time buyers within California. These programs recognize the unique challenges faced by those new to the car market and aim to provide support and guidance.

Benefits of First Time Car Buyer Programs

Opting for a first time car buyer program can offer several advantages:

  • Easier Loan Approval: These programs often have more lenient approval criteria compared to standard auto loans, acknowledging the limited credit history of first-time buyers.
  • Potentially Lower Interest Rates: Some programs may offer reduced APRs to make financing more affordable for first-time buyers.
  • Guidance and Support: Dealerships offering these programs often provide extra support and education throughout the buying process, which is invaluable when you’re new to car buying.
  • Building Credit: Successfully managing a car loan is a great way to build your credit history, which can benefit you in future financial endeavors.

Qualifying for First Time Car Buyer Programs in California

While specific requirements vary depending on the lender and program, typical qualifications for first time car buyer programs in California include:

  • Proof of Income: Lenders need to ensure you can comfortably afford car payments. Providing pay stubs or bank statements is usually necessary.
  • Stable Employment: A steady job history demonstrates your ability to consistently make payments over the loan term.
  • Down Payment: While some programs might have low or no down payment options, having a down payment can increase your chances of approval and potentially lower your monthly payments.
  • Valid Driver’s License and Insurance: You’ll need to be a licensed driver and have car insurance to legally drive your new vehicle.
  • Residency in California: Programs are typically offered to California residents.

It’s important to note that even with first time buyer programs, lenders will still assess your overall financial situation to determine loan eligibility and terms.

Tips for First Time Car Buyers in California

Beyond exploring first time buyer programs, here are essential tips to navigate your first car purchase in California:

  1. Determine Your Budget: Before you start browsing cars, figure out how much you can realistically afford each month for a car payment, insurance, and fuel. Use online car loan calculators to estimate monthly payments based on different loan amounts and interest rates.
  2. Choose the Right Type of Car: Consider your needs and lifestyle. Do you need a fuel-efficient sedan for commuting in Los Angeles traffic, or an SUV for weekend trips to the mountains? Explore both new and used car options.
  3. Check Your Credit Score: Understanding your credit score is crucial as it impacts the interest rates you’ll qualify for. Obtain your credit report from one of the major credit bureaus and address any errors or issues.
  4. Shop Around for Financing: Don’t just rely on dealership financing. Explore options from banks, credit unions, and online lenders to compare interest rates and loan terms.

  6. Negotiate the Price: Don’t be afraid to negotiate the car price. Research the fair market value of the vehicle you’re interested in and aim for a price at or below that.
  7. Understand All Costs: Factor in not just the car price and loan payments, but also insurance, registration fees, sales tax, and ongoing maintenance costs.
